易语言实战:轻松掌握域名解析技巧与步骤

资源类型:00-9.net 2024-11-09 07:45

易语言 域名解析简介:



易语言与域名解析:开启高效网络编程的新篇章 在信息化高速发展的今天,互联网已成为我们日常生活和工作中不可或缺的一部分

    无论是访问网站、发送电子邮件,还是进行在线购物、视频通话,域名解析都在其中扮演着至关重要的角色

    然而,对于许多编程爱好者和初学者来说,域名解析往往是一个复杂而难以掌握的概念

    幸运的是,易语言作为一种简单易学、功能强大的编程语言,为我们提供了一个全新的视角和工具,让域名解析变得不再遥不可及

     一、易语言:编程新手的福音 易语言,顾名思义,就是一门容易学习和使用的编程语言

    它采用中文作为编程语言的主要表述方式,大大降低了编程的门槛,使得更多没有编程基础的人能够轻松上手

    易语言不仅支持基本的变量、函数、控制结构等编程要素,还提供了丰富的库函数和模块,使得开发者能够快速地开发出各种实用的应用程序

     在易语言的生态系统中,网络编程是一个重要的应用领域

    通过易语言,开发者可以轻松地实现网络通信、数据传输等功能,而域名解析则是网络编程中不可或缺的一环

    通过域名解析,我们可以将人类易于记忆的域名(如www.example.com)转换为计算机能够识别的IP地址(如192.168.1.1),从而实现网络通信

     二、域名解析:网络世界的桥梁 域名解析,又称DNS解析,是互联网中的一个核心机制

    它负责将域名转换为IP地址,使得用户可以通过输入域名来访问对应的网站或服务

    域名解析的过程大致可以分为以下几个步骤: 1.用户输入域名:当用户在浏览器中输入一个域名时,浏览器会向DNS服务器发送一个查询请求

     2.DNS服务器查询:DNS服务器接收到查询请求后,会首先在自己的缓存中查找该域名对应的IP地址

    如果找到了,就直接返回给用户;如果没有找到,就向其他DNS服务器发起递归查询

     3.递归查询:如果本地DNS服务器无法找到对应的IP地址,它会向根DNS服务器发起查询请求

    根DNS服务器会返回顶级域(如.com、.net等)的DNS服务器地址

    本地DNS服务器再向这些顶级域DNS服务器发起查询请求,依次类推,直到找到最终的IP地址

     4.返回IP地址:一旦找到了对应的IP地址,DNS服务器就会将其返回给用户的浏览器

    浏览器再使用这个IP地址与服务器建立连接,从而完成访问

     三、易语言在域名解析中的应用 易语言作为一种简单易学的编程语言,为开发者提供了丰富的网络编程工具和库函数,使得域名解析变得轻松简单

    以下是一些易语言在域名解析中的具体应用: 1. 域名到IP地址的解析 易语言提供了专门的DNS查询函数,如“取域名IP()”,该函数可以接收一个域名作为参数,并返回该域名对应的IP地址

    这使得开发者在编写网络应用程序时,可以轻松地实现域名到IP地址的解析功能

     语言 .版本 2 .支持库 shell .子程序 _启动子程序 .局部变量 域名, 文本型 .局部变量 IP地址, 文本型 域名 = “www.example.com” IP地址 = 取域名IP (域名) 调试输出(IP地址) 在上面的示例中,我们使用“取域名IP()”函数将域名“www.example.com”解析为对应的IP地址,并通过调试输出显示出来

     2. IP地址到域名的反向解析 除了域名到IP地址的解析外,易语言还支持IP地址到域名的反向解析

    这通常用于网络安全、日志分析等场景

    易语言可以通过调用系统命令或第三方库函数来实现这一功能

     3. 异步域名解析 在网络编程中,异步操作是一种常用的技术手段,它可以提高程序的响应速度和性能

    易语言支持异步域名解析功能,使得开发者可以在不阻塞主线程的情况下进行域名解析操作

    这通常通过多线程或异步回调的方式来实现

     4. 域名解析缓存 为了提高域名解析的效率,易语言开发者通常会实现域名解析缓存机制

    将解析结果缓存起来,当再次需要解析相同的域名时,可以直接从缓存中获取结果,而无需再次向DNS服务器发起查询请求

    这可以大大减少网络延迟和带宽消耗

     四、易语言域名解析的优势与挑战 优势 1.简单易学:易语言采用中文编程,降低了学习门槛,使得更多没有编程基础的人能够轻松掌握域名解析技术

     2.功能强大:易语言提供了丰富的网络编程工具和库函数,使得开发者可以快速地实现域名解析等网络功能

     3.高效性能:通过优化算法和异步操作等技术手段,易语言可以实现高效的域名解析性能

     挑战 1.DNS污染与劫持:在互联网环境中,DNS污染与劫持是常见的安全问题

    易语言开发者需

阅读全文
上一篇:掌握技巧:如何顺利购买已注册并心仪的域名

最新收录:

  • 轻松指南:如何重启你的云服务器
  • 耐思尼克域名转出指南:轻松掌握域名转移步骤
  • TP5框架实战:轻松获取网站域名技巧揭秘
  • 万网域名出售流程全解析:轻松掌握如何出售你的域名
  • 万网域名转出教程:轻松掌握域名转移步骤
  • 掌握域名解析IP命令,轻松实现网址定位与诊断
  • 耐思尼克域名转出教程:轻松掌握域名转移技巧
  • 轻松掌握:如何查询域名到期时间的实用技巧
  • 掌握技巧:轻松解析中文域名全攻略
  • 寻找优质老域名?这些平台帮你轻松购买!
  • 万网域名申请注册指南:轻松拥有您的专属网络地址
  • GoDaddy域名转入全攻略:轻松转移您的域名到GoDaddy
  • 首页 | 易语言 域名解析:易语言实战:轻松掌握域名解析技巧与步骤